PATENTS REGULATIONS 1991 - REG 2.2C

Information made publicly available--other circumstances

  (1)   This regulation sets out:

  (a)   for paragraph   24(1)(a) of the Act--a circumstance in relation to information made publicly available by, or with the consent of, the nominated person, patentee or predecessor in title of the nominated person or patentee; and

  (b)   for subsection   24(1) of the Act--a period for making a complete application for an invention if the circumstance applies.

Circumstance

  (2)   The circumstance is that the information has been made publicly available in circumstances other than the circumstances described in regulations   2.2, 2.2A and 2.2B.

Period

  (3)   The period for making a complete application for the invention is 12 months from the day the information was made publicly available.
